Output fd3956821a000696caa1555a7984c52e97d54b71ff57e622c344de993c567888:0

value
10132092
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6eeb4b4ca483e633117e406cd850b705b6eee7af OP_EQUALVERIFY OP_CHECKSIG
address
1B7VCdERLMh3D9QJevrJb1rVCTbtfHbuBn
transaction
fd3956821a000696caa1555a7984c52e97d54b71ff57e622c344de993c567888
spent
true